Output 04a1ba35334e01251b5c6983261364781dd60e942d64b0f2e11faa0b7b1b4ebb:0

value
6945917134030
script pubkey
OP_0 OP_PUSHBYTES_20 d70fb1def173e550849f9f08457e84fa51edc065
address
tb1q6u8mrhh3w0j4ppylnuyy2l5ylfg7msr9xukq3z
transaction
04a1ba35334e01251b5c6983261364781dd60e942d64b0f2e11faa0b7b1b4ebb
confirmations
185966
spent
true